Picking up and storing goods

NOTE
Loads that are not positioned and secured in
accordance with the regulations pose an acci-
dent risk.
Instruct all personnel to vacate the truck's
hazard area. If any person is located in the
hazard area, stop the truck immediately.
Only transport loads that have been posi-
tioned and secured in accordance with reg-
ulations. Adopt appropriate protective
measures if the load is at risk of tipping over
or falling during transport.
You must not transport goods using dam-
aged transportation tools (such as trucks,
pallets etc.).
Never go under raised load-bearing compo-
nents.
Personnel are prohibited from entering load
components.
You must not use the truck to lift personnel.
Try to move the forks until they are com-
pletely under the goods.
CAUTION
Before picking up a load, the operator must ensure
that it has been correctly stacked.
The weight of the load must not exceed the truck's
rated load capacity.
Do not place long loads sideways across the forks.
